Gain Power by Giving it Away! Cooperative Classroom Management
Having a cooperative classroom atmosphere starts at the beginning of the school year. Involve students in writing classroom rules. Let them become involved with "town meetings" to discuss and evaluate how things are going in the classroom. Teach students how to be "peer peacemakers." A teacher who tries to control the classroom often gets into power struggles with the students. Instead of trying to control, try to inspire and motivate others to do their best.
